Preparation and Cooking Time
Understanding the time commitment for the Low Carb Spinach Mushroom Feta Crustless Quiche is vital for planning your meal. Here’s a breakdown of the time required:
– Preparation Time: 15-20 minutes
– Cooking Time: 30-35 minutes
– Total Time: Approximately 50-55 minutes

Ingredients
– 4 large eggs
– 1 cup fresh spinach, chopped
– 1 cup mushrooms, sliced
– 1/2 cup feta cheese, crumbled
– 1/2 cup heavy cream
– 1/2 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or mozzarella)
– 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
– 1/4 teaspoon salt
– 1/4 teaspoon pepper
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ating the Low Carb Spinach Mushroom Feta Crustless Quiche is straightforward if you follow these simple steps:
1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. Sauté Vegetables: In a skillet over medium heat, add olive oil. Once hot, add sliced mushrooms and cook until they are soft. Then add spinach and cook for 2-3 minutes until wilted.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
3. Prepare Egg Mixture: In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until well combined.
4. Combine Ingredients: Stir in the cooled spinach and mushroom mixture into the egg mixture. Then add crumbled feta cheese and shredded cheese, mixing well.
5. Transfer to Dish: Pour the mixture into a greased pie dish or quiche pan, spreading it evenly.
6. Bake: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the quiche is set and lightly golden on top.
7. Cool & Slice: After baking, let the quiche cool for about 10 minutes. Then slice and serve warm.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Ingredients: For the best flavor and texture, opt for fresh spinach and mushrooms. They elevate the dish and ensure maximum nutrients.
– Experiment with Cheeses: While feta adds creaminess, you can try other cheeses like goat cheese or Gruyère for unique flavors.
– Add Spices: Consider incorporating spices like cayenne pepper for heat or Italian herbs for an aromatic kick.
– Perfect the Baking Time: Every oven is different, so check the quiche a few minutes before the suggested time. It’s done when the edges are set, and the center is slightly jiggly.
– Personalize Your Greens: Feel free to throw in other greens like kale or Swiss chard for added nutritional benefits.
Recipe Variation
Mix it up with these exciting variations:
1. Meat Lover’s Quiche: Add cooked sausage or bacon for extra protein and flavor. Ensure the meat is well-drained before adding it to the egg mixture.
2. Mediterranean Twist: Incorporate sun-dried tomatoes and black olives for a Mediterranean flair that pairs perfectly with feta.
3. Spicy Kick: Add diced jalapeños or red pepper flakes to give your quiche a spicy dimension that will excite your palate.
4. Onion and Leeks: Enhance the flavor with caramelized onions or sautéed leeks for a sweeter taste profile.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Keep your quiche in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It remains fresh for about 3-4 days, making it perfect for meal prep.
– Freezing: You can freeze the quiche for up to 3 months. To do this, let it cool completely, slice it, and wrap each piece tightly in plastic wrap. Place the wrapped quiche in a freezer-safe bag or container.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I add more vegetables?
Absolutely! Veggies like bell peppers, zucchini, or asparagus can work well. Just remember to sauté them first.
How do I know when it’s done?
The quiche is ready when it’s slightly puffed and set in the middle. A toothpick inserted should come out clean.
